Tamil Nadu Weather: The Regional Meteorological Center (RMC), Chennai, has issued a very heavy rain alert for multiple Tamil Nadu districts until June 18. A red alert for heavy to very heavy rainfall has been issued for isolated areas in the Nilgiris and Coimbatore’s ghat sections. Tenkasi and Theni districts are also expected to witness heavy rainfall. Light to moderate showers are likely to occur over the weekend in Tamil Nadu, Puducherry, and Karaikal. Chennai will see partly cloudy skies with moderate rain, accompanied by thunder and lightning. Rain activity is likely to continue in Tamil Nadu till June 22.

As per RMC, an upper air cyclonic circulation prevailing over the northwest Bay of Bengal is expected to intensify into a low-pressure area by June 17. The system is likely to deepen further and move in a northwesterly direction in the coming days.
